Ligatus expands into UK and appoints Alex Mcllvenny as Country Manager

Leading native advertising solutions provider, Ligatus, today announced it has expanded into the UK with the opening of a new London office and the appointment of Alex McIIvenny as Country Manager.

Ligatus, which is headquartered in Germany and has an established presence in 10 other countries across the world, offers solutions for publishers, advertisers, and programmatic buyers. The move into the UK represents a strategic next step for the company, and reflects the growing needs of domestic and international advertisers based in London for enhanced native advertising solutions.

As UK Country Manager, McIlvenny will focus on extending the existing Ligatus reach to the international hub of agencies, trading desks, and DSPs in the UK, and developing close relationships with local publishers to build a Ligatus UK network by the end of the year.

Before joining Ligatus, McIlvenny was Managing Director and Group Sales Director at Mozoo, where he was responsible for growing the company’s brand presence, market share, and revenues across the UK and France. Prior to Mozoo, Alex was the first hire for Widespace UK as Head of Sales, where he spent over two years building the business into one of the UK’s most recognisable mobile advertising technologies chosen by media agencies. Alex also spent five years working as Head of International Media at Haymarket Publishing.
